Crying Freeman (クライングフリーマン Kuraingu Furīman ) is a Manga of Ryôichi Ikegami.
Pre-published in French in the review Kaméha with the editions Glénat, then published in the same editor, the publication was stopped after two volumes. Today, in fact the Kabuto Editions took again the series, whose ninth volume was translated in November 2006. The original series counts ten volumes.
